BTWXT Games is using the Google Maps API as the main navigation user interface for their location-based games website.
In the past we've seen websites such as Invisible Playground and Google Maps Road Trip use Google Maps as a background for a website page. BTWXT Games, however, is a little different as it actually uses different map overlays almost as a replacement for different pages on the website.
When you first load the website the Google Map is centred on an overlay with links to two of the location-based games available from BTWXT Games. If you click on either link the map pans to another overlay with information about that game.
